About Veterinary Care in Castlebar
Castlebar has 8 veterinary clinics with an excellent average Google rating of 4.9/5 across 392 reviews. Pet owners have a solid range of local options for routine pet care, and weekend access is a notable plus, with 5 clinics open at weekends.

Castlebar looks like a genuinely strong town for everyday veterinary care. There is enough choice to compare convenience, approach, and availability without the field feeling overwhelming, and the review pattern suggests owner satisfaction is spread across the town rather than resting on just one standout practice. For routine check-ups, vaccinations, minor illnesses, and ongoing care, most pet owners should feel confident that Castlebar offers several credible places to start.
The main weakness is transparency rather than apparent quality. None of the clinic listings are currently verified, so it is sensible to confirm key details yourself before booking, especially if you are choosing based on hours, appointment availability, or a particular service. Weekend access is a real advantage in Castlebar and should make routine visits easier for working owners, but late-evening cover is limited. More importantly, there is no local emergency veterinary service, so if your pet develops a serious problem outside normal hours, you may need to travel out of area.
For most owners, choosing between vets in Castlebar will come down to fit rather than obvious quality gaps. If your pet has an ongoing condition, ask how follow-up care is handled and whether you can usually see the same clinician. If convenience matters most, check how easy it is to get a short-notice appointment and what weekend availability actually looks like in practice. For anxious pets or first-time owners, even a brief call can reveal a lot about communication style and how the clinic manages nervous animals.
Because Castlebar has a broad service mix, it makes sense to build a relationship with a local practice before you are under pressure. Register early, ask what happens outside normal hours, and keep an out-of-area emergency plan in place. In a town like this, preparation matters more than chasing small differences between otherwise well-regarded options.

8 clinicsAll Paws Veterinary Hospital is an independent clinic in Castlebar, established in 2023 and owned and operated by veterinarians Leonie Slowey and Clare Eugster. The clinic offers routine care alongside medicine, surgery, dentistry and acupuncture, with consultations by appointment and an on-call vet available via the regular phone number outside normal hours. Recent feedback consistently highlights gentle handling, clear explanations and thoughtful follow-up in both routine and difficult cases.
Breaffy Veterinary Clinic in Castlebar is a small-practice-feeling clinic where owners often mention quick appointments, caring handling, and memorable follow-up care. Recent feedback highlights very fast turnaround for routine visits, while older detailed accounts also point to repeat checks, medication, and injections when a pet needed ongoing treatment. Named staff are remembered positively, which adds to the sense of personal service.
McHale Road Veterinary Surgery is a mixed practice in Castlebar caring for both large and small animals. The clinic also offers walk-in clinics, and reviews mention routine dog care as well as treatment for ear and eye problems. Written feedback presents the practice as compassionate, straightforward, and gentle in handling pets.
Castle Vets is a mixed practice in Castlebar, treating a range of animals. Whether it is independently owned or part of a wider group is not stated. Owner feedback points to a clinic that handles both routine care and more urgent cases, including emergency surgery, alongside ongoing support for longer-term health issues.
Animal Hospital appears to be an independent veterinary practice in Castlebar, as no group ownership is stated. It offers general companion-animal care, with reviews highlighting routine consultations, urgent help, senior-pet assessments, and end-of-life support. Owners often describe vets who take time to explain options, involve them in decisions, and handle pets gently.

Ballyvary Veterinary Clinic in Castlebar, Mayo is a local veterinary practice with recent feedback centred on prompt help, friendly service, and clear communication. Reviews point to general pet consultations and treatment, with owners also highlighting the team’s listening skills and patient care. Named staff are mentioned warmly by customers for being helpful, kind, and easy to deal with.
George O'Malley Veterinary is a veterinary clinic in Castlebar, Mayo. Public information is limited, but the small number of recent reviews suggests a positive client experience, with comments highlighting friendly, helpful staff.
Viviana Equine Vet is a veterinary practice in Castlebar, Mayo with a strong overall Google rating and a small but very positive set of written reviews. The practice appears focused on equine care, with reviews highlighting professional service, practical advice, gentle handling, and access to X-ray imaging. Publicly visible feedback is limited, but the tone is consistently favourable.
